The Basics of Cock Rings: What Are They For?

Cock rings work by restricting blood flow to the penis, which can help in achieving a firmer, longer-lasting erection. Some wear them around just the base of the penis, while others prefer models that also encompass the balls, intensifying the pressure and adding to the overall sensation.

Metal Cock Rings: Cold, Hard, and Unyielding

Material Overview: Metal cock rings, typically made from stainless steel, aluminum, or chrome, are rigid and non-flexible. They come in various sizes, but one thing remains consistent: once it’s on, there’s no give. This means finding the perfect size is crucial. Many BDSM enthusiasts are drawn to metal for its weight, sleek aesthetic, and the feeling of immovable restraint it provides.

Benefits of Metal Cock Rings:

  1. Firm Pressure for Maximum Effect: Metal cock rings don’t flex or stretch, meaning the pressure remains constant throughout use. This creates a more intense experience as the ring holds firmly against the base of the penis, restricting blood flow more efficiently than softer materials.
  2. Long-Lasting Durability: Metal rings are extremely durable and built to last a lifetime. No worries about wear and tear; they won’t degrade over time like other materials. Plus, they’re easy to clean with a simple wipe-down or soak in hot water.
  3. Weight and Sensation: The weight of a metal cock ring adds an additional sensory dimension. Some people enjoy the heaviness against their body, which can enhance the feeling of restraint and heighten arousal.
  4. Aesthetic Appeal: Metal cock rings have a sleek, polished appearance that many find sexy and intimidating. Whether you’re using it during solo play or with a partner, metal rings can provide a visual edge that adds to the intensity of the experience.

Drawbacks of Metal Cock Rings:

  • Sizing is Crucial: Metal doesn’t stretch, so you need to be absolutely sure of your size. Too tight, and it can become uncomfortable or dangerous; too loose, and it won’t provide the desired effects. A good rule of thumb is to measure yourself while erect and choose a ring about 1-2mm smaller than your circumference.
  • Not Beginner-Friendly: If you’re new to cock rings, metal may not be the best starting point. The rigid nature means there’s no room for error. It’s best to work up to metal once you’re more familiar with how cock rings feel and fit.
  • Temperature Sensation: Metal retains temperature, so if you’re into temperature play, this could be a bonus. However, if you’re not prepared for a cold shock, you might want to warm it up before use!

Silicone Cock Rings: Soft, Stretchy, and Versatile

Material Overview: Silicone cock rings are made from high-grade, body-safe silicone. They are flexible, stretchy, and come in various sizes, shapes, and even colors. Silicone is a softer material compared to metal, which makes it a popular choice for beginners and those looking for comfort alongside pleasure.

Benefits of Silicone Cock Rings:

  1. Flexibility and Comfort: Silicone rings are extremely forgiving in terms of size and fit. They stretch to accommodate your girth, providing a snug yet comfortable grip without feeling overly tight. This makes them ideal for both beginners and those who prefer a gentler sensation.
  2. Safe for Longer Wear: Because silicone is soft and flexible, it’s a safer option for prolonged use. You can enjoy your cock ring for extended periods without worrying about cutting off circulation too much or causing discomfort.
  3. Easy to Use: Putting on and taking off a silicone ring is much simpler than with metal. The stretchy nature means you can slip it on even after you’re already hard, or if you want to try it around your cock and balls, it’s much easier to maneuver into place.
  4. Variety and Playfulness: Silicone cock rings often come in fun, bright colors and different designs. Some even have added textures or vibrating features to enhance pleasure further.

Drawbacks of Silicone Cock Rings:

  • Less Intense Pressure: The flexibility of silicone means that it won’t offer the same tight, unyielding pressure as metal. While this can be a benefit for some, others might miss the firmness and intensity that a rigid ring provides.
  • Not as Durable: While high-quality silicone can last for years, it won’t have the same lifetime durability as metal. Over time, repeated stretching can cause it to lose elasticity or even tear.
  • Cleaning Needs Attention: Silicone can pick up lint, dust, and oils more easily than metal, meaning it requires more thorough cleaning. Always ensure you use a body-safe toy cleaner or soap and water before and after every use.

How to Choose: Metal vs Silicone

So, how do you choose between metal and silicone? Consider the following factors:

  • Experience Level: If you’re a beginner, silicone is often the best place to start. Its flexibility and comfort will let you ease into the sensation without the risk of getting stuck in a too-tight ring. Metal, on the other hand, is better suited for experienced users who know their size and are looking for a more intense, restrictive experience.
  • Desired Sensation: Do you crave the firm, unyielding pressure of a solid ring, or do you prefer something softer and more comfortable? Metal provides maximum restriction, which some users love for its intensity. Silicone is better for those who want a snug fit but with a bit more give.
  • Duration of Wear: Planning on wearing the ring for extended play sessions? Silicone is typically more comfortable for long-term wear, while metal should generally only be worn for shorter periods to avoid discomfort or complications.
  • Visual and Sensory Preferences: If you’re into the visual appeal of sleek, cold metal or the weight it adds, a metal cock ring is the way to go. If you enjoy the playful colors, softer textures, and possible added features like vibrations, silicone is your friend.
